A 2,000-kg test car, traveling 60 m/s hits a brick wall. Using motion pictures, the time involved is determined to be 0.050 s. What is the magnitude of the force that the car exerts on the wall?

The force will be


2.4 * 10^6 N

Step-by-step explanation

As given in question

Mass= 2000 kg

Velocity= 60 m/s

Time = 0.05 sec

As we know


Acceleration = Velocity/Time


Acceleration = 60 / 0.05


Acceleration = 1200 ms^(-2)

For force we know that


Force= Mass * Acceleration


Force= 2000 x 1200


Force = 2400000 N


Force = 2.4 * 10^6 N

So, The answer is


Force = 2.4 * 10^6 N
